Responding for the first time to CNN’s report of his botched punking of one its reporters, James O’Keefe claims in a statement posted on his website that he “was repulsed by the over-the-top language and symbolism that was suggested in the memo that was sent to me, and never considered that for a moment.” Yet, at the same time, O’Keefe says, “I’ll admit that I liked the basic absurdity of meeting Abbie Boudreau on a boat and the idea of counter-seduction satire executed in a tame, humorous, non-threatening manner.”
